Weft Knitting Garment Fabric Sourcing Guide
Sourcing weft knitting garment fabric requires a nuanced understanding of how loop structures influence drape, elasticity, and end-use performance. Unlike woven textiles, which rely on the interlacing of perpendicular yarns, weft knitting creates fabric by interlocking loops of yarn in a horizontal direction. This fundamental structural difference grants the material inherent stretch and recovery, making it a preferred choice for apparel that requires comfort and freedom of movement. Buyers must recognize that the specific knitting technique—whether it be Raschel, Tricot, or standard jersey—dictates the fabric’s stability, porosity, and suitability for various garment types.
The procurement process for these materials involves balancing aesthetic preferences with functional requirements. Market listings often highlight a wide variety of styles, from plain dyed solids to complex mesh constructions designed for sublimation printing. Understanding the distinction between warp and weft knitting is critical, as warp knits generally offer greater dimensional stability, while weft knits provide superior elasticity. Procurement teams must align their material selection with the specific mechanical demands of the final garment, ensuring that the chosen fabric can withstand the stresses of wear, washing, and manufacturing processes without compromising its structural integrity.
Product Scope and Observed Listing Signals
The current market landscape for weft knitting fabrics displays a diverse range of material compositions and technical specifications. Observed listings indicate that 100% Polyester is a dominant material choice, often selected for its durability, colorfastness, and cost-effectiveness. However, blends such as Nylon with Spandex are also prevalent, particularly in applications requiring enhanced stretch and recovery. These material variations directly impact the fabric’s hand feel, moisture management properties, and suitability for different climate conditions, necessitating careful verification of composition before placing orders.
Listing signals further reveal significant variation in weight, width, and finishing processes. Weight ranges observed in the market span from lightweight options under 100g/m² to heavier fabrics exceeding 200g/m², catering to everything from summer activewear to winter base layers. Widths are commonly standardized at 58/60 inches, which facilitates efficient pattern cutting and minimizes waste during garment production. Additionally, features such as wicking capabilities, anti-yellowing properties for printing, and shrink resistance are frequently highlighted, indicating that buyers should prioritize fabrics with specific post-processing treatments that align with their brand’s quality standards.
Technical Specifications to Verify
Verifying the technical specifications of weft knitting fabrics is essential to ensure they meet the functional requirements of the final product. Buyers must confirm the exact knitting technique, such as Raschel or Tricot, as this determines the fabric’s structure and potential for distortion. For instance, Raschel knitting is often used for openwork or mesh fabrics, while Tricot knitting provides a smooth, stable surface suitable for lingerie and linings. Understanding these technical distinctions helps prevent mismatches between the fabric’s inherent properties and the garment’s design intent.
Weight and density are critical parameters that influence the fabric’s drape and opacity. Procurement teams should verify the Grams per Square Meter (GSM) to ensure it aligns with the desired garment weight and seasonality. Listings may specify weights such as 45-200gsm or ranges like 100-200g/m², but buyers must request physical samples to confirm the actual density. Additionally, verifying the yarn count, such as 50D, 75D, or 100D, provides insight into the fineness and strength of the yarn used, which affects the fabric’s texture and durability.
Compliance and Safety Documentation
Compliance and safety documentation are non-negotiable aspects of sourcing garment fabrics, particularly for international markets. Buyers must ensure that suppliers can provide relevant test reports and certifications that verify the fabric’s safety for human contact. While specific certification statuses may vary by supplier, standards such as OEKO-TEX are commonly referenced in the industry to indicate that the textile has been tested for harmful substances. Procurement teams should request these documents to confirm that the fabric meets regulatory requirements for chemical safety and environmental impact.
In addition to chemical safety, buyers should verify compliance with flammability and labeling standards specific to the target market. For example, garments intended for children or specific regions may require stricter flammability testing. It is crucial to establish clear communication with suppliers regarding their ability to provide comprehensive compliance documentation. This includes not only safety certifications but also accurate fiber content labels and care instructions, which are essential for maintaining brand integrity and avoiding legal liabilities.
Cost Drivers and Commercial Terms
Understanding the cost drivers associated with weft knitting fabrics allows buyers to negotiate more effectively and forecast budgets accurately. Key factors influencing price include the material composition, knitting complexity, and finishing processes. Fabrics with specialized features, such as wicking or anti-yellowing properties, typically command higher prices due to the additional processing required. Similarly, custom colors and patterns, such as plain dyed or yarn-dyed options, may incur setup fees or minimum order quantity (MOQ) requirements that affect the overall cost per unit.
Commercial terms, including MOQs and payment conditions, vary significantly across suppliers. Observed MOQs can range from small quantities for sampling to large volumes for mass production, with some suppliers offering flexible terms for established partners. Buyers should clarify packing details, such as roll packing in plastic bags or on tough tubes, as improper packaging can lead to damage during transit. Additionally, understanding lead times and shipping methods, whether by sea or air, is crucial for managing inventory levels and ensuring timely delivery to production facilities.
